Ca' Foscari University of Venice has a national and international outstanding reputation for academic excellence in both teaching and research. Founded on 6th August 1868 as the first Italian high school devoted to commerce and economics, it has grown and developed new relevant subject areas.
The students regularly enrolled at Ca' Foscari are about 18,500 at the moment, with 560 professors. The new graduates are 2,400 every year. Ca' Foscari provides 19 academic departments, 6 research centres, an efficient library system providing access to 700,000 books and 400,600 periodicals and an extensive network of PCs and workstations. Moreover, the University carries out research, consulting and training activities for public and private organizations; it is involved in partnerships with several Venetian cultural institutions and associations in the framework of scientific information, training and research. Every year almost 300 cultural and scientific events are organized by Ca' Foscari. |
